MTBE enters the environment and biodegrades very slowly, thus lurking in
water for decades or more.
Presently, the EPA does not have adequate data
to estimate potential health risks of MTBE at low exposure levels in drinking
water, but supports the conclusion that MTBE is a potential human carcinogen at
high doses.
